Carrick v. Lámar
Citations
- 116 U.S. 423
- 6 S. Ct. 424
- 29 L. Ed. 677
- 1886 U.S. LEXIS 1781
Syllabus
<p>In matters which require an executive officer of the United States to exercise judgment or consideration, or which are dependent upon his discretion, no rule will issue for a mandamus to control his action.</p> <p>Whether the island in the Mississippi River opposite St. Louis, known as Arsenal Island, shall be surveyed and brought into the market is a matter within executive discretion and judgment.</p>
